Estate-Will* | Joseph Perry Crosswait left a will dated 20 May 1871 at Cass Co., Iowa, naming son Perry R Crosswait as executor. The only named heir was his beloved wife Mary R Crosswait who was to receive one-third of the estate. Unnamed heirs were all his children who were to split the remaining two-thirds of the estate. Son Isaac Newton had previously been advanced money and was to have no share in the will. By the time of Joseph's codicil of 20 May 1875 daughter Mary had died and her share was given to daughter Jennie B Cary.10 |
Residence* | Joseph and Mary resided in Atlantic, Cass Co., Iowa, on 25 October 1873, when their daughter Mrs. Dr. McClary (Sarah Arminta) vistied them.11 |
Estate-Codicil* | He made a codicil on 20 May 1875 at Cass Co., Iowa, shifting the share of his now deceased daughter Mary to Mary's daughter Jennie B Cary.10 |
Estate-Codicil | He made a second codicil at Cass Co., Iowa, on 20 May 1875, in which he shifted the bequest to his granddaughter Jennie B Cary to a trust in which his son Perry R Crosswait would be trustee, and to hold those monies in trust until Jenny was 30 years of age. The handwritten date of this 2nd codicil in Iowa Wills reads 'this 20th AD 1875' with month missing. I'm assuming it was written the same day as codicil no. 1.10 |

ResearchNote* | Research Note of 24 June 2021 re daughters. Henry & Sally Shreves Blair had two daughters, Sarah J "Sallie" Blair & Jenetta Blair, born one after the other, who seem to get mixed up and sometimes merged into on in the available online resources. Living with the parents, the 1850 census lists 7 yo daughter Sarah and a 6 yo daughter Jenetta. The 1860 census lists 15 yo Sallie & 14 yo Jenetta. The 1870 census lists only 27 yo Sallie J Blair. This is the first appearance of the middle initial J for Sarah "Sallie". I've not seen Jenette called anything but that or variations thereof. Sarah is always Sarah or Sallie. Perhaps the middle initial J, if correct at all, is for Jane but it's very unlikely her parents named two daughters Jenette one after the other. Henry's FSTrees entry, ID no. LC58-DDM, shows a daughter Sallie Jenette Blair (1843- ) and a daughter Sallie Blair (1845- ). These trees are frequently wrong so that's no big surprise. It seems that FSTrees has merged sources for the two daughters into one person. |Henry W. Blair (1811-a1870.)5 |
